- Sherman_E._Burroughs_(United_States_Navy) abstract "Rear Admiral Sherman E. Burroughs, Jr. (February 22, 1903 – September 23, 1992) was a senior officer in the United States Navy, and the first commander of the Naval Air Weapons Station China Lake originally known as the Naval Ordnance Test Station (NOTS).".
